After 15 years of operation, the Youth TV channel VTV6 of Vietnam Television will officially disband on October 14. From October 15, 2022, VTV6 will be replaced by VTV Can Tho TV channel.

Previously, according to Decree No. 60/2022/ND-CP on the organization, tasks and powers of Vietnam Television, VTV6 was no longer part of the system of departments and offices of the Station. This means that the Youth Department was officially abolished from September 8, 2022.

That's why, since the beginning of September, many famous editors and MCs of VTV6 have sadly said goodbye to the Youth Department.

According to BTV Ton Hieu Anh, the biggest regret for him and his colleagues is having to say goodbye to programs familiar to young people such as:Happy Lunch, Glass Bottle, Fashion Studio, Dare to Live, Women with Taste, Rainbow…The programs that VTV6 members have created are handmade in a sophisticated way. The biggest regret is that VTV6 has super strong staff to make live TV shows.

Commemorative photo of members of the Youth Union. Photo: NVCC.

Editor Ton Hieu Anh revealed that after VTV6 officially disbands, its staff will be accepted by 9 different units within Vietnam Television. The wish will be fulfilled for each member.

"Personally, I am strong in shows so I chose to join the Entertainment Program Production Department, the first place I worked when I joined the station. I think, although I am quite insecure because of my age, it also gives the station and myself one last chance to be together. Change and elimination are inevitable when fate ends. Meeting old leaders also helps me to be less worried and integrate into the new environment," Editor Ton Hieu Anh confided.
